On 2002-09-30 10:12, Socketd <db@traceroute.dk> wrote:
> Let's make a layer from top to button:
>	Gnome/KDE
>	GKT/QT
>	Windows manager like Sawfish
>	X windows

Use a fixed-width font when previewing the diagram below.
This is more like:

	+-----------+---------------+---------+----------------+
	|    KDE    |  QT-programs  |  Gnome  |  GTK programs  |
	+-----------+---------------+--------------------------+
	|          QT library       |     GTK library          |
	+---------------------------+--------------------------+
	|                     X11 libraries                    |
	+------------------------------------------------------+

> Right? So qt and kde programs can't run under gnome/gkt?!?!

You can have both QT-based and GTK-based programs running at the same
time.  I haven't seen many people do it, but you could probably run
most of the Gnome programs within an already running KDE desktop.
